汽轮机末级叶片的冲刷,一直是影响电站安全运行的难题之一。目前生产厂家只对新机组末级叶片进行硬质合金和其他方法的保护处理,而对于运行时间较长的旧机组的末及叶片,却没有一个可靠的修复保护措施。此文针对此问题,详细阐述了采用氩弧焊工艺进行补焊及试验的一些方法。由于措施得当,完成了665mm末级叶片的修复工作,并经13000多h的运行考验,情况良好,为今后修复焊接提供了比较可靠的工艺方法。
